Integrate Custom Data Sources

To gain a comprehensive view of your AI models, integrate custom data sources such as logs, databases, or APIs. This allows you to pull in real-time metrics like accuracy, precision, recall, and F1 scores. Use Whatagraph’s API integration capabilities to automate data fetching and ensure your dashboards are always up-to-date.

Create Dynamic and Interactive Dashboards

Leverage Whatagraph’s interactive features to enable dynamic filtering and drill-down capabilities. For example, add filters for different model versions, datasets, or time ranges. This helps stakeholders quickly identify issues or trends without creating multiple static reports.

Use Advanced Chart Types

Beyond basic line and bar charts, utilize advanced visualizations such as heatmaps, scatter plots, and performance over time graphs. These can reveal correlations and patterns in your metrics, such as the relationship between data drift and model accuracy.

Implement Custom Metrics

Create custom metrics tailored to your specific use case. For instance, track the latency of predictions, model confidence levels, or the frequency of specific errors. Incorporate these into your dashboards to monitor aspects that matter most to your application.

Set Up Automated Alerts

Configure Whatagraph to send alerts when performance metrics fall below thresholds. Automated notifications can be sent via email or Slack, enabling rapid response to issues such as model degradation or data anomalies.

Optimize Data Refresh Rates

Adjust the refresh intervals based on your needs. For real-time monitoring, set shorter refresh cycles; for periodic reviews, longer intervals may suffice. Proper optimization ensures your dashboards are both timely and resource-efficient.

Leverage Templates for Consistency

Create reusable dashboard templates to maintain consistency across reports. Templates streamline the process of setting up new visualizations and ensure that all stakeholders view metrics in a standardized format.
